Las Virgenes Noms Super Corredora, Meaning Head Santa Anita Worktab

Freshly anointed champion juvenile filly Super Corredora (Gun Runner), GI Breeders' Cup Juvenile Fillies fourth-place finisher Meaning (Gun Runner) and GSP Nimah (Gun Runner) were among a sextet of 3-year-old fillies nominated to next weekend's Las Virgenes Stakes who recorded timed workouts Sunday at Santa Anita.

Super Corredora worked four furlongs in :48.0 (13/84) for trainer John Sadler. The bay was last seen winning the Breeders' Cup Juvenile Fillies Oct. 31 at Del Mar.

Working five furlongs on Sunday, Meaning completed the task in 1:01.60 (30/71). Nimah, who was third in the GII Starlet Stakes in December, worked five furlongs in 1:00.6 (5/71) for Baffert. The $550,000 Fasig-Tipton Saratoga Select yearling purchase is campaigned by Zedan Racing Stables.

Sunday's workers also heading to the Las Virgenes includes SW Cee Drew (Cistron) (4f :50.20 70/84) and Fortunate Truth (Authentic) (4f :50.20, 70/84), both trained by Dan Blacker; and Wild Like the West (Into Mischief) (4f :49.40, 26/33) for trainer Richard Baltas.

Baffert also worked 3-year-old colts GISP Plutarch (Into Mischief) and GI Hopeful runner-up and TDN Rising Star, presented by Hagyard Buetane (Tiz the Law), who are both nominated to Saturday's GIII Robert B. Lewis Stakes. Buetane, a $1.15-million OBS Spring Sale juvenile purchase, is also entered in this Friday's GIII Southwest Stakes at Oaklawn. Buetane worked four furlongs in :47.80 (8/84), while Plutarch, who broke his maiden last out on turf Nov. 30 at Del Mar, worked six furlongs in 1:12.2 (1/6).
